Both teams were expected to gun for the title this season but as this fixture looms, their chances are also looming away too. Liverpool dropped out of the championship run already before it started while Arsenal’s dream of the Premiership faded last weekend. Both Arsenal and Liverpool is in a need of the three points to salvage whatever there is in their title run.

In a space of a week, Arsenal managed to throw away their title challenge in the hands of Manchester United and Chelsea. Two weekend ago, Arsenal lost 3-1 at the Emirates Stadium to Manchester United and that followed up with a 2-0 defeat at Chelsea last weekend. Manager Arsene Wenger is more than disappointed with his team’s performance and their lacklustre results in the two games. They will now face fourth place, Liverpool, in search to close the gap between them and the top and keeping the third place in the Premiership.

Liverpool will travel to the Emirates in the midweek tie with high confidence and high spirit to London. They have recently beaten their bitter rivals, Everton, with 10 men last Saturday in a hard fought battle at Anfield. Manager Rafa Benitez is happy that his team is showing progress and getting the right result compared to the first half of the Premiership season. He will be without Kyrgiakos as he was sent off against Everton while Fernando Torres is still out injured.

Arsenal can do the double over Liverpool this season but that might not happen if they defend properly. Liverpool have been looking solid for some time and they are deadly on the counter attack so Arsenal should know what to expect. Liverpool are still without a striker that can give them goals but Dirk Kuyt has been providing them the necessity they are longing for.
